Why the map you grew up with disagrees
On a Mercator map, area grows with distance from the equator. Belize sits at about 17°N and is stretched to 1.1× its true area; Philippines at 12° N is stretched to 1.04×. Here the two are distorted about the same amount, so Mercator gets this pair roughly right. The figure above uses the Equal Earth projection, where every square kilometre is drawn the same size.
